Perfect Square
8942071491809152031654936438025507830244 is a perfect square (94562526889932208662 × 94562526889932208662)
8942071491809152031654936438025507830244 is a perfect square (94562526889932208662 × 94562526889932208662)
8942071491809152031654936438025507830244 is even
Previous even number is 8942071491809152031654936438025507830242
Next even number is 8942071491809152031654936438025507830246
715013782343883182132007609439195169950563732378930509878329488392523123876644910793661353813341856040135985017315166784
79960642564625953709947400354101275058681712266758211510090878711147756721099536
1101001000111010001000101001100111001010001011110110001011110110100100010110001111111001011011101011101001111011001111111100111100100